Renowned for its durability and accuracy, the GP100 was introduced by Sturm, Ruger & Co. in 1985 as an improvement upon the Security Six series. The revolver's robust frame and durable components were specially designed to handle the powerful .357 Magnum cartridge, making it a favorite among law enforcement and civilians alike. The 1994 model inherits these strengths, featuring a solid, one-piece cylinder frame and a modular grip frame that enhance both durability and recoil management. The GP100's DA/SA operation, combined with a smooth trigger pull, ensures a seamless shooting experience, whether for practice at the range or in critical self-defense situations.
